Higher Up Is Tazo

1h 35m

Higher Up Is Tazo is a documentary film. directed by Tornike Bziava.

Starring Tazo Saralidze, Tsisana Saralidze, and Khatuna Saralidze

Synopsis

The villager boy feels the most comfortable when he is in the mountains, where he is following his father's footsteps. When he goes on a field trip with his classmates or finds himself in other social settings, he is more timid and apprehensive. When in the village, Tazo is mostly directed by his grandmother. Tazo is the most obeying when he is with his mother. Tazo's father takes him to the city for the first time, where a lot of things are novel for the boy.
